> Perhaps you can point me in the right direction. I have been
> reminiscing about my childhood summers (1950's) spent in East
> Rutherford, NJ. I recall my uncle commuting to work in NYC from a
> station at the end of the street (Vanderburgh Avenue), along side a
> waterway (canal ?). I remember the line as the DL & W.
> =

> What I am seaching for is the name of the railway station and its
> precise location.



That was the ERIE's Carleton Hill Station, on Erie Ave and Jackson Ave in=
 the
northwest part of RUTHERFORD (no East).  Closed since the rearrangement o=
f
lines in the late 1960's that combined parts of the DLW Boonton Line with=

parts of the Erie Main and Greenwood Lake lines.
